Continue ReadingIn this new series of articles, I will be posting positional breakdowns by conference so you can get to know who might be taking the field next season. For this article, I will be talking about the quarterbacks within the 3A Metro – Sound Conference.
Nathan Hale HS: Ismail Guyo c/o 2026. Ismail started last year as just a freshman and showed a lot of promise on the field. He is an elite dual-threat at the quarterback position, being able to move with his legs nicely and avoid defenders with ease. He has a strong arm and great field vision, seeing his receivers right when they are getting open.
Franklin HS: Avery Stewart c/o 2025. From what I have heard from players within the Franklin team, Avery will be starting at the quarterback position to start the season. Stewart played WR/DB last year and showed off tremendous athleticism. He could make some noise at this position this year.
Cleveland HS: I could not locate who would be starting at QB come week 1 for Cleveland HS.
Chief Sealth HS: Issac Martinez c/o 2024. Issac is an all-metro league quarterback already and has great size for the position. He runs very well with his legs, showing off his athleticism often when he scrambles outside the pocket. Martinez has a strong arm, being able to sling the ball down the field 30+ yards down to his receivers.
Lakeside (Seattle) HS: Thomas Ephrem c/o 2024. Thomas stands at 6’2″ and can move really well not only within the pocket but outside the pocket as well. He rolls to his right and accurately hits his receivers often but can also tuck the ball to gain positive yardage with ease too. He is going to have a big year, in my eyes.
West Seattle HS: Bo Gionet c/o 2024. Bo could be the most athletic quarterback within this conference. He has showcased his abilities to scramble well with the ball tucked under his arm and can make defenders miss with his athletic skill moves. He has a solid arm too, throwing the ball accurately to his targets, especially when they are able to get open.
